The comfort of your home reaches far beyond the temperature reading on your thermostat. Improving the overall quality of your indoor air impacts the health of your family, the condition of your home and even energy costs.
One of the most important elements of indoor air quality is humidity. Controlling humidity is possible with humidifiers and whole house dehumidifiers. These products work within your central air system to reduce the effects of humidity.
We all know that a humid environment is uncomfortable. Your home’s air conditioning is a great escape from a steamy summer day. Within your living space, a humid climate may aggravate asthma symptoms, trigger allergies and often allows mold spores to move throughout your home. A dehumidifier helps remove excess moisture from the air circulating through your HVAC system.

A whole house dehumidifier is better for your home than individual room dehumidifiers. A whole house system treats all the air within your home. By removing excessive moisture in the air before it enters the air ducts and moves through your vents, everyone breathes easier in every corner of your home.
The impact of a whole house dehumidifier benefits your home, your energy usage, and, most notably, improves the air quality for your family’s health.
Benefits of a whole house dehumidifier impacts the well-being of your home by preventing mold growth, wood rot and eliminating musty smell. Excess humidity can create issues within the ducts and cause undo wear on air conditioner and furnace components. When you control humidity in your home, you help prevent repairs to the structure and expensive appliances.
Dry environments are more comfortable during the spring and summer months. When you reduce humidity to the ideal level, air temperature can often be adjusted. Adjusting your thermostat to a higher temperature and running your air conditioner less frequently may lower your energy bill.
The health of your family is one of the most important reasons to install a dehumidifier into your home. Drier air is healthier for family members who suffer from allergies, asthma and other respiratory illnesses. Reducing mildew and mold is an obvious benefit. Using a dehumidifier may reduce the pests and dust mites that prefer moisture in the air.
